Oscar Valdambrini

About Oscar Valdambrini

b. 11 May 1924, Turin, Italy. Valdambrini learnt the trumpet and violin as a child and studied at Turin Conservatory. He worked with a variety of local groups in the 40s and played in a jam session with Rex Stewart in 1948. He formed a quintet with saxophonist Gianni Basso in 1955; this band has played in various guises intermittently right through to the late 80s. It has always been one of the most highly rated Italian bands, in which Valdambrini has been able to display an excellent technique in the bop-orientated playing he favours. He has also worked with various big bands including those of Lionel Hampton and Maynard Ferguson. In 1967 and 1968 he joined Duke Ellington’s Orchestra for concerts in Milan. Since 1972 he has also played with the Television Orchestra of Rome.
